The City of Fort Pierce hosted its 5th Annual Highwaymen Heritage Art Show and Festival on February 15, 2020. Along with the Festival, local 5th grade students participated in an art contest, giving them the opportunity to learn Fort Pierce’s Highwaymen history, and were encouraged to paint landscape scenes symbolic to the Highwaymen style. The contest entries were judged by the Arts and Culture Advisory Board, and the winners were announced at the Festival. Students with winning entries also received an engraved medallion commemorating the event, a certificate of achievement and a $25 gift card. Winning art departments received $300 for 1st place, $250 for 2nd Place and $200 for 3rd Place.
1st Place – Elena Cazares, St. Anastasia Catholic School
2nd Place – Brandon Leitenbauer, Fairlawn Elementary
3rd Place – Trinity Hanson, Frances K. Sweet Elementary
Honorable Mention – Julia Pereira, C.A.S.T
